Fix multiplication producing a negative zero
Fix mbedtls_mpi_mul_mpi() when one of the operands is zero and the
other is negative. The sign of the result must be 1, since some
library functions do not treat {-1, 0, NULL} or {-1, n, {0}} as
representing the value 0.

+ * Fix some cases in the bignum module where the library constructed an
+ unintended representation of the value 0 which was not processed
+ correctly by some bignum operations. This could happen when
+ mbedtls_mpi_read_string() was called on "-0", or when
+ mbedtls_mpi_mul_mpi() and mbedtls_mpi_mul_int() was called with one of
+ the arguments being negative and the other being 0. Fixes #4643.
